What is Personalized Education?

Personalized education is a teaching approach that customizes learning experiences based on a student's individual strengths, weaknesses, interests, and learning styles. Unlike traditional methods, it focuses on the learner rather than the curriculum. This approach enables students to have more control over their learning journey, fostering a deeper engagement with the material.

Key Components of Personalized Learning

Several elements are crucial to implementing personalized education effectively:

  • Adaptive Learning Technologies: Use of software that adjusts content according to student performance.
  • Student-Centered Curriculum: Focuses on interests and goals specific to each learner.
  • Flexible Pacing: Allows students to progress at their own speed, ensuring mastery of each topic.

Benefits of Personalized Education

The advantages of this educational approach are manifold. By catering to individual needs, personalized education can enhance student motivation and improve learning outcomes. Students are more likely to retain information and develop critical thinking skills when they are actively engaged in their education.

Empowering Educators and Learners

Personalized education not only benefits students but also empowers educators. Teachers can leverage data to understand each student's progress and challenges better. This allows for more targeted interventions and support, leading to a more effective teaching process.

The Role of Technology

Technology plays a pivotal role in the implementation of personalized education. With the advent of AI and machine learning, educational platforms can now offer adaptive learning experiences that are continuously refined based on student interactions. This technological integration makes personalized education more accessible and scalable.

Challenges and Considerations

Despite its potential, personalized education comes with challenges. Ensuring equity in access to technology and resources is crucial. Additionally, the effectiveness of personalized learning heavily depends on the quality of the data collected and the algorithms used to analyze it.
